Greatest American Dog Show – Episode 6

So when we last left off, the house had just lost Brandy and Beacon leaving the door wide open for Travis and Laura to start getting more and more flirtatious without having the potential of a Tonya Harding kneecap take down on Laura.  JD was even giving Travis a hard time about “getting her number” after the show is over….. If this was Big Brother we’d be heading towards some grainy video footage from the Dog Bone Suite!

The episode revolved around doggie IQ and intelligence and according to Beth Joy she has had Bella Starlet tested and declares him very smart.  However, Bill and Star actually earn the right to the suite and in a payback for last week’s episode let’s Teresa and Leroy take the suite.  This time was certainly less emotional than Bill getting to see photos of his family.

Best in Show stays on the intelligence theme and the dogs are put to painting a picture that represents the bond between pet and owner.   The show is called Salvador Doggy!

We get another Leg Up for winning the Dog Bone Challenge and Teresa gets the good fortune to work with the famed Dog Art Instructor Kirsten McMillan.  As stated by our gracious host Jarod Miller introducing the animal trainer with years of experience, and “in fact she even teaches dogs how to paint!”

Beth Joy (who happens to admit to being a Seinfeld’s Elaine Benes impersonator in real life) is proud of her little “Pawcaso”.

Laura struggles to pull off her grand vision and fails big time getting it done.  Judge Wendy Diamond stops the presentation to say “I have to be honest .. this sucks” .. NOW things get fun!

Trying to defend her art work she immediately throws Beth Joy under the bus by claiming that she was hurting Bella Starlet in the process of them doing their own painting.  This is the first time that the contestants have watched the proceedings from the green room on TV so they all could see what was happening!  OOOH…. theres going to be a throwdown

Upon returning to the green room, Beth Joy confronts Laura with a “would you like to explain your call out?”

Laura retorts with an “I’m not going to fight with you … it’s really not worth it!” … but fails to convince anyone of her motives as they all look awkwardly on.

During the final segment the judges ask Beth Joy about the accusations and she proclaims Laura’s comments a “pathetic attempt on her part to distract from her faults on her painting” … THEN Travis jumps in to be the good guy and defends Beth Joy from Laura’s accusations … DAGGERS fly from Laura’s eyes and that’s the end of that.  No Dog Bone Suite for you buster …..

Laura and Preston are expelled so no more flirting and Travis and his commitment issues live to fight another day … what now?
